## Changelog — Tidewhisk 2.8

Renamed `SWEEP_TOKEN` to `TIDEWHISK_CLEANUP_TOKEN` so support can distinguish the stale-branch bot's credential from the merge-queue one. Old name is read with a deprecation warning until 3.0. When helping customers migrate, have them update their env file so the new variable sits directly below this comment line.

env line for fafof-fahag: LEDGER_TOKEN5=f8790

## Service Accounts: Proctor Queue

The `svc-examflow-queue` account drains submissions from the Invigil8 proctoring queue and writes verdicts back to the session store. Reviewers should confirm that new consumers reuse this account rather than minting their own; queue permissions are deliberately narrow. The account authenticates to the internal queue broker with a static key, rotated quarterly. The current key is listed directly below.

app token of bahaf-tajeg = zpat23_SjjsllwiLmXbtS65veZaV47

**Vendor note: Inkmill markdown pipeline**

Rendering for Parchway docs is outsourced to Inkmill under an annual contract, renewing each March. They handle sanitization and PDF export; we own the upload queue. SLA: 4-hour response on rendering failures. Escalate only after two failed retries. Their support desk is reachable at the address below.

billing contact of hahaf-baguf = zorael.tammir.jorius@sivrelhq.internal